The Presidential Academy ranks 1st in the country for training managers and executives.
On June 17, 2026, at the forum "Three Missions of Russian Education," which took place in Moscow, the ranking of the 100 best universities according to RAEX was presented. Over three years, the Presidential Academy has risen 5 places and now occupies the 8th position, falling behind Lomonosov Moscow State University, Bauman Moscow State Technical University, Moscow Institute of Physics and Technology, Saint Petersburg State University, National Research Nuclear University MEPhI, Higher School of Economics, and MGIMO.
The Russian Academy of National Economy and Public Administration (RANEPA) topped the ranking of universities in the field of management and public and municipal administration. In terms of the demand for graduates by employers, the university ranks 2nd in the country.
"Today, graduates of the Academy occupy leadership positions significantly faster than others in both the public sector and the largest companies in Russia. The average Unified State Exam score of those entering our budget and paid places is steadily increasing. And, of course, we continue our active work on scientific and methodological support for government authorities, ranking first in the country for comprehensive scientific socio-humanitarian expertise," noted the rector of the Presidential Academy, Alexey Komissarov.
Unlike many university rankings, the methodology of RAEX subject rankings is entirely based on objective statistical indicators and does not use subjective expert assessments. The ranking of the best universities in Russia, RAEX-100, has been published annually since 2012. In compiling the ranking, experts assess the quality of education (weight in the result calculation 50%), the demand for university graduates by employers (weight 30%), as well as the level of scientific research activity at the university (weight 20%). A total of 45 indicators are used in the ranking.
Since 2022, the agency has been preparing subject rankings of universities. In 2026, 167 universities from 45 regions of the country were included in the lists, and 35 subject rankings were compiled across a wide range of natural and engineering sciences, social and humanitarian fields, mathematics, medicine, pedagogy, and agriculture.
"The RAEX subject ranking is one of the key industry rankings of Russian universities in the field of economics, management, and business education. The top positions in the ranking occupied by the Academy prove the effectiveness of the programs used in preparing future managers," noted the director of the Nizhny Novgorod Institute of Management, Ekaterina Lebedeva.
